STUDENTS from Five Islands Academy on the Isles of Scilly have brought Shakespeare to life in a striking new way, with three bespoke flags now flying proudly above Holgate Green on St Mary's.
 
 The King Lear flags in place at Holgate Green on St Mary's
The flags are the culmination of a creative education project inspired by the Royal Shakespeare Company's (RSC) first-ever visit to the Isles of Scilly.
As part of the company's outreach work surrounding its new 80-minute production, First Encounters: King Lear, Five Islands Academy students engaged in a series of workshops exploring themes from the play - ranging from sibling rivalry to devolution - guided by RSC director Justine Themen, who visited the islands ahead of the performances.
